-- Module:CRTBrandList
-- Dynamically generates a list of CRT brand buttons by querying
-- distinct brands from actual CRT model pages.
-- This approach ensures all brands with at least one CRT model appear,
-- even if they don't have a dedicated brand category page.
local p = {}
local function trim(s)
if s == nil then return nil end
s = tostring(s)
s = s:gsub('^%s+', ''):gsub('%s+$', '')
if s == '' then return nil end
return s
end
function p.list(frame)
local args = frame.args
local linkType = trim(args.link)
-- Query distinct brands from actual CRT model pages
local queryWikitext =
'{{#ask:\n' ..
' [[Category:CRT models]]\n' ..
' [[Has brand::+]]\n' ..
' |?Has brand\n' ..
' |format=broadtable\n' ..
' |headers=hide\n' ..
' |link=none\n' ..
' |mainlabel=-\n' ..
' |limit=5000\n' ..
' |searchlabel=\n' ..
'}}'
local queryResult = frame:preprocess(queryWikitext)
-- Extract and deduplicate brand names from result
local seen = {}
local brandsList = {}
if queryResult then
for cellContent in queryResult:gmatch('<td[^>]*>(.-)</td>') do
local brand = trim(cellContent:gsub('<[^>]+>', ''))
if brand and brand ~= '' and not seen[brand] then
seen[brand] = true
table.insert(brandsList, brand)
end
end
end
-- Sort alphabetically
table.sort(brandsList)
if #brandsList == 0 then
return '<p><em>No CRT brands found.</em></p>'
end
-- Build the output: render each brand using Template:Brand entry
local output = {}
for _, brand in ipairs(brandsList) do
local templateCall
if linkType then
templateCall = '{{Brand entry|brand=' .. brand .. '|link=' .. linkType .. '}}'
else
templateCall = '{{Brand entry|brand=' .. brand .. '}}'
end
table.insert(output, frame:preprocess(templateCall))
end
return table.concat(output, '\n')
end
return p
